Port Washington city, Wisconsin Per Capita Income By Race and Ethnicity in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on December 3, 2023.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the Per Capita Income for Port Washington city, WI was $35,990.

By Race: The American Indian & Alaska Native Alone racial group had the highest per capita income in Port Washington city, WI ($75.07K), followed by White Alone ($37.47K), and Some Other Race Alone ($33.24K). The racial group with the lowest per capita income was Black Alone ($7.57K).

By Ethnicity: The per capita income of the Non-Hispanic White Alone ethnicity group was ($37.62K), and that of the Hispanic or Latino of All Races ethnicity group was ($25.25K).
